Concentration of
Carbon Dioxide
In the synthesis of glucose, carbon dioxide is needed in the dark reaction as raw material.
If there is no other factor limiting the photosynthesis, an increase in the concentration of carbon dioxide gas will cause an increase in the rate of photosynthesis.
If temperature and light intensity are constant, increase in concentration of carbon dioxide will increase the rate of photosynthesis until a certain level and the rate of photosynthesis will not increase anymore.
This is because light intensity becomes the limiting factors.

Light Intensity
Light is needed during light reaction of photosynthesis ( photolysis of water).
If the concentration of carbon dioxide and temperature are controlled, increase in light intensity will increase the rate of photosynthesis until it reaches a certain point.
After this point, the rate of photosynthesis will not increase anymore.
This is because other factors such as concentration of carbon dioxide become the limiting factor.
The rate of photosynthesis can be increased by increasing the concentration of carbon dioxide.
At a very high light intensities, the rate of photosynthesis can be slows down because the pigment chlorophyll is damaged by ultraviolet.

Water
Water is required for photosynthesis.
However, it is rarely a limiting factor in photosynthesis. This is because water is needed in a very small amount in photosynthesis.
If water is not supplied, wilting will occurs and this results in the closing of stomata.
This prevents the diffusion of CO2 into the leaves. Therefore, the rate of photosynthesis decreases because of the lower of concentration of CO2 which become the limiting factor.
Temperature
The dark reaction of photosynthesis is catalysed by the photosynthetic enzymes ad, therefore, the rate of photosynthesis will affect by the changes in temperature.
The rate of photosynthesis increases when the temperature increases.( Every 10oC doubled the rate of photosynthesis.)
When the temperature is too high, the rate of photosynthesis decreases and finally stops altogether. This is because the photosynthetic enzymes denatured at high temperature.
